[1] If I get a another person’s or animal’s blood, urine, or feces on my body, will that break my wudu?
[2] What if you see that you have one minute left before the current prayer time is over. You are in a state of wudu but you know that you can not finish the first raka of the current prayer before the time is over. Should you start prayer or wait until the time is over and pray it as a qada?

[1] The legal cause for the nullification of your wudu is the exiting of filth from your person. As for being affected by filth from another person or an animal, this would follow the rules of removing filth. Thus you would wash away the filth, yet your wudu would remain unaffected.
[2] You should pray a minimal prayer by performing the obligatory actions only, and finish within the time. The obligatory acts of the prayer are five: the standing, recitation, bowing, two prostrations, and the final sitting. You can easily perform such a prayer within 30 seconds or less. However, it would be highly recommended to repeat such a prayer, with all of its necessary and sunna actions, after the time exits.
